AMI offers a line of diode drivers for both high current and low current applications. AMI's Model 7701A is an OEM high current driver designed for high power DPSS laser and illumination applications. The compact OEM package provides currents up to 300A pulsed or 50A CW via a floating output. The Model 7701A employs a DB-25 connector for external control and a heat sink and fan are provided. 

The 779A Series provides currents up to 120A pulsed or 30A CW. The Model 779A allows for trimpot or external adjustment of current amplitude, pulsewidth, and pulse repetition rate and trimpot adjustment of over-current limit.  AMI's Model 5705 can be used as an external power supply for either driver.

The new 780 Series are efficient CW and QCW OEM driver assemblies for operating single high power laser diodes. Consult factory for militarized and RoHS version.

Laser Diode Power Modules
The Model 5705 is an isolated laser diode power module, which uses a proprietary power conversion technique to charge energy storage capacitors for CW or pulsed diode-pumped solid-state laser applications. AMI also offers other OEM custom drivers for low current applications.

Laser Diode Controllers
The Model 8800D laser diode controller provides pulsed output currents to drive laser diodes for pumping solid-state lasers. An internal microprocessor
provides the flexibility and convenience of software control and the system status is presented on an easy-to-read LCD graphics display. The 8800D can be configured with one or two power modules for up to 2.8kW of output power. Protection features of the 8800D include an adjustable precision current limit which protects the laser diode from exceeding its maximum rating.

For strictly CW applications, the Model 880D CW diode controller offers higher average powers at a reduced price. The Model 880D includes an active power factor corrected front end and can be configured with two or three internal power modules to provide up to 6kW for CW diode loads. Control of the Model 880D can be achieved from the front panel or remotely via an RS-232 interface. An external gate input allows for quasi-CW operation of the Model 880D.
